It’s called
Everyone Can be a herO.
It’s a fictionalised account of what happened.

There has already been a nuclear accident and there aren't too many resources left either. People have to grow food wherever they can.
It's the summer holidays, however, and four teenagers would like to spend it helping on the family allotments, making music with their friends and generally lolling around. The trouble is that, although the people are trying to build a better future, does the government have a different agenda? Where are the nuclear trains going? Why do they only run at night and where are they stopping? What are they unloading? Why will no-one talk about it and where have the good guys gone?
It's up to the teenagers to find out. Armed with little else than solid-wheeled bicycles, cameras and some memory sticks, they travel through a different, greener England, organically farmed and self-sufficient. What they find, and how they tell people, changes the future of the country.
